Steel giant to sponsor London 2012 26/05/2010
|
|
| |
| |
ArcelorMittal has signed up as a tier two sponsor and the official steel supporter of the London 2012 Olympics.
The deal follows confirmation that ArcelorMittal will fund the construction of a 115-metre tall visitor attraction in the Olympic Park called ‘The Orbit’.
London 2012 chairman Lord Coe said: “The Olympic Games and Paralympic Games are already transforming East London and the addition of the Tower at Games-time will provide an added dimension to the park.
“We are thrilled to have ArcelorMittal on board as a sponsor and I have great pleasure in welcoming them to the London 2012 family.”
Lakshmi Mittal, chairman and chief executive of ArcelorMittal, added: “With the Games being the world’s biggest sporting event, we felt that London 2012 was the perfect sponsorship opportunity.
“We’re excited about being associated with this great global sporting event and being able to showcase the versatility of steel at it with the ArcelorMittal Orbit. I’m also personally pleased to be able to give a little something back with this initiative to London, which has been my home for many years.”
